Hunter College vs. Mesivta of Eastern Parkway-Yeshiva Zichron Meilech

Both CUNY Hunter College and Mesivta of Eastern Parkway-Yeshiva Zichron Meilech are 4 years schools located in New York. The following statements compare CUNY Hunter College and Mesivta of Eastern Parkway-Yeshiva Zichron Meilech with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
  • Hunter College's tuition ($15,332) is more expensive than Mesivta of Eastern Parkway-Yeshiva Zichron Meilech ($10,100).
  • Hunter College's acceptance rate (54.05%) is lower than Mesivta of Eastern Parkway-Yeshiva Zichron Meilech (62.50%).
  • Mesivta of Eastern Parkway-Yeshiva Zichron Meilech has higher yield (100.00%) than Hunter College (18.58%).
  • Both schools have same SAT scores of 1,350.
  • Both schools have same students to faculty ratio of 14 to 1.
  • Hunter College (22,879 students) is larger than Mesivta of Eastern Parkway-Yeshiva Zichron Meilech (42 students) with more enrolled students.
  • Mesivta of Eastern Parkway-Yeshiva Zichron Meilech ($9,677) has higher amount of financial aid than Hunter College ($8,751).
  • Mesivta of Eastern Parkway-Yeshiva Zichron Meilech's graduation rate (75%) is higher than Hunter College (61%).
